In Memory Of
Roger John Dimmer
1925 - 2019
Roger grew up in Green Bay and graduated from East High, Class of 1945. Roger enlisted in the US Army and proudly served his country during the Korean War from 1952-1954. He worked at James River Paper Mill for 40 years. He married Beatrice Klarkowski in Green Bay.
Roger is survived by his sons, Jim (Lynette) Dimmer of Maribel and Paul Dimmer of Green Bay; his daughter, Amy (Ray) Ermis of Green Bay; grandchildren: Troy (Tavia) Smits, Ray (Angela) Ermis III, Ryan and Ashley Ermis and Jazmin and Jacob Schindler and 4 great-grandchildren. He is further survived by his nieces, nephews, other relatives and good friend, Jim Stutmen.
He was preceded in death by his brothers: Anton, Gerhard, Leo, Raymond and James and a sister, Betty.
Visitation will be held at Newcomer-Green Bay Chapel (340 S. Monroe Ave., Green Bay), Sunday, March 3, 2019 from 4 to 6 PM. A funeral service will follow at 6 PM with full military honors.
The family would like to thank Crossroads Nursing Home and the Unity Hospice staff for all their help and compassion.
